We stayed here for four nights and had a really good experience. It’s a bit off-grid, but the neighborhood is very safe, and the hostess is incredibly kind! There were some ants in the room in the evening because they could come under the door, but they are working on that and it’s wasn’t really a bother because it’s not during the day or night. Our room had a fan and a private bathroom. We were also able to use the laundry area in the back. The food was delicious, we had both breakfast and dinner here, and it was very affordable and delicious. You can rent a scooter, but we got around by bus. The location is close to Charco Verde and Ojo de Agua, but quite far from Playa Mangos and El Pital. If you don’t want to rent a scooter like us, we’d recommend taking a tuk-tuk for those places. May (the hostess) even taught me some Spanish words and phrases and explained everything about the island. She is truly so sweet!

Warm and welcoming guest houses are ideal for travellers who prefer unfussy accommodation with a personal touch. They are usually family-run, and your host will provide local recommendations and optional meals. Often cheaper than regular hotels, guest houses can also feature a cosy living room and a garden.
It's a family-run Hostel/Homestay with very friendly owners. Super cool and very authentic, located in the jungle where you have screaming monkeys in the morning and fireflies in the evening. Amazing view over Concepción volcano. You can eat here or at Comedor Cristina 300m north fairly cheap. Tap water is drinkable. It's pretty quiet and not as frequented as other parts of the island. Showers and toilets are in the rooms, just as fans and power plugs. It's near to San Ramón waterfall and Maderas hiking trail.
